Chicken and Basil Stir-fry

Ready in 40 minutes
You will need:

  • a large skillet or wok
Ingredients
Recipe for 4 servings
  • Chicken breast halves (boneless, skinless crosswise into 1/4-inch thick slices) - 1 1/2 lbs
  • Salt and ground pepper - to taste
  • Vegetable oil
  • Small onion (halved and cut into 1/4 inch thick wedges - 1
  • Bell peppers (red, yellow, green or a mix, ribs and seeds removed; cut into 1/4 inch wide strips) - 2
  • Garlic cloves (minced) - 6
  • Rice vinegar - 2 tbs
  • Soy sauce - 2 tbs
  • Basil leaves - 1 and 1/2 cups
Directions:

  1. Season chicken generously with salt and pepper.
  2. In a large wok or non stick skillet, heat 
    • 2 tsp of oil and fry
      • chicken until browned but not completely cooked. 
  3. Transfer to plate and set aside.
  4. To the skillet, add 
    • oil and fry
      • Onion
      • Bell peppers
    • cook over medium high heat, tossing often, until beginning to brown. Add
      • Garlic
    • Cook until fragrant.
  5. Add 
    • 1/4 cup of water
    • Vinegar
    • Soy sauce
    • fried chicken
  6. Cook, tossing, until chicken is cooked through.
  7. Remove from heat and stir in 
    • Basil leaves
  8. Serve with white rice.
Footnotes:
The chicken can be coated in cornstarch before frying to have a more crispier chicken.
